A friction hinge should keep a door in place wherever it is left, even in the presence of movement or vibration. The health and safety advantages for inspection panels on machinery are clear and they can make life much easier for single handed operation.
In a public space friction hinges are just as essential but a hinge which is visible from the exterior is vulnerable to attack from undesirables. A hidden torque hinge like the HG-TU cannot be seen when the door is closed keeping it, and your installation, safe from attack.
Constant torque friction hinges are great when there's a lot of movement or vibration but when you have say a heavy lid they add significantly to the effort of lifting the lid. A one way torque hinge like the HG-TQA has torque in one direction only. So when lifting the lid there is no resistance but the lid will stay in place where you leave it - so long as gravity is behaving itself.

The torque moment of a friction hinge is attributed to two surfaces rubbing together generating friction to limit movement. The tolerances are very fine not only to give the desired torque but also to remain reliable in operation.
